Civil Engineer

Salary Range: $866 to 1,213 per month

Join a real estate developer with an active portfolio of ground-up and value-add projects. In this role, you'll support multiple development projects by helping coordinate design decisions, consultant drawings, and project documentation into clear, construction-ready packages.

What You'll Do:

  • Maintain and update CAD drawings to reflect coordinated decisions between the design team, architect of record, and other consultants.
  • Identify and resolve conflicts between disciplines, including layouts, structural drawings, MEP drawings, and ceiling plans.
  • Flag items requiring ownership input and help move open design issues, RFIs, and decisions through to closure.
  • Prepare clean, consistent drawing packages for ownership review and handoff to the general contractor for bidding and construction.
  • Attend virtual design coordination meetings, take notes, and translate outcomes into drawing updates.
  • Interface directly with ownership to confirm design intent and obtain sign-offs at key milestones.
  • Support the bid process by ensuring documentation is complete, clear, and ready for contractor review.
  • Assist with submittal review and design clarifications during construction.

Who You'll Work With:

Be an integral part of an owner-side project team working closely with ownership, designers, architects, engineering consultants, and contractors to keep multiple development projects coordinated, organized, and moving forward.

Who We're Looking For:

  • Education: Degree in civil engineering, architecture, or related engineering field.
  • Technical Skills: Must be proficient in AutoCAD. Revit, SketchUp, and Bluebeam are helpful but not required.
  • Organized: Keeps on top of projects and does not let tasks fall through the cracks.
  • Drawing Knowledge: Able to read and reconcile architectural, structural, and MEP drawings.
  • Detail-Oriented: Strong attention to detail and organizational discipline with version control and drawing logs.
  • Communication: Clear written and verbal communication, with comfort interfacing directly with principals, designers, and contractors.
  • Composed: Able to stay calm, professional, and solution-focused in high-pressure conversations.
  • Self-Starter: Able to drive items to closure without heavy supervision.
